While the flesh of apples isn’t toxic for cats, the stem, leaves and seeds can be, as they all contain cyanide. Yes, an occasional small piece of apple flesh is generally fine for cats to eat, but this fruit is not a necessary part of their diet. Apples are not a natural food for cats, but they can be a healthy treat in moderation. Remove the apple seeds and core before offering it to your cat, as apple seeds contain small amounts of cyanide, which can be harmful if ingested in large quantities. Apple stems, leaves, and seeds contain cyanide, which can be toxic to cats in large amounts. The stems, leaves, and seeds of an apple all contain a chemical.
